Daha in context

With 120 people at the 2011 Census, Daha was the 821st most populous of its district's 924 villages, below the district average of 1,476.

Literacy stood at 43.40%, 21.5 points below the district's rural average of 64.92%.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1800, 877 above the rural national 923.

49.2% of the population were recorded as workers, 11.3 points above the district's rural rate.
